1 sack chopped romaine lettuce, 10 ounces

1/2 cup special black pitted olives from the fancy olive bins near the deli

1 roasted red pepper, sliced

24 slices pepperoni

12 grape tomatoes

 

Italian Blender Dressing:

3 splashes red wine vinegar, about 3 tablespoons

2 tablespoons green salad olives with red pimento and juice

6 leaves fresh basil, torn up

Handful flat-leaf parsley leaves, 2 to 3 tablespoons

3 big spoonfuls grated Parmigiano-Reggiano or Romano

A few grinds black pepper

1/2 cup extra-virgin olive oil, eyeball it

 

Pour lettuce into a big salad bowl. Break up the olives a little with your clean fingers. Scatter the olives and the sliced red peppers around the salad. Add in the grape tomatoes and the pepperoni slices, too. Into a blender, pour the vinegar. Add the olives, herbs, and cheese, the pepper and oil, too. Have the GH (grown-up helper) place the lid on blender and blend the dressing until everything is all chopped up and mixed up together. Pour dressing over the salad and toss it up good.
